Bratislava Hosted the Regional Final of the European Law Moot Court Competition 2026
From 5–8 February 2026, the Bratislava Regional Final of the prestigious European Law Moot Court Competition (ELMC) took place on the premises of the Faculty of Law of Comenius University in Bratislava.
The European Law Moot Court Competition ranks among the most prestigious student competitions in the field of European Union law and simulates proceedings before the Court of Justice of the European Union.
What the European Law Moot Court Competition Is
It is an international competition based on simulated court hearings in the field of European Union law. Teams composed of law students first prepare a fictional case and subsequently present their legal arguments before an expert panel.
During the proceedings, they appear in both procedural capacities:
- applicant
- defendant
The hearings are conducted primarily in English. As part of the event and its accompanying programme, French is also used, as it is among the traditional languages of the legal environment of the European Union.
Programme of the Bratislava Regional Final
The event took place over four days, and its programme was divided as follows:
- Thursday – formal welcome of the participants during the welcome reception
- Friday – preliminary rounds of the competition on the premises of the Faculty of Law of Comenius University
- Saturday – semi-final rounds and the grand final
- Final – ceremonially held in the representative Assembly Hall of Comenius University
Expert Panel
The advancement of the individual teams was decided by an international expert panel (judicial bench), composed of practitioners from Slovakia and abroad.
In its evaluation, it focused in particular on:
- the quality of legal analysis
- the persuasiveness of the arguments
- the standard of oral advocacy

Grand European Final
The overall winner from among the best European teams will be determined in the final round, which traditionally takes place at the European Court in Luxembourg.
